  • Patent number: 11875326
    Abstract: Systems and methods associated with media hub devices are provided that passively monitor user devices and transmit targeted media through in-channel transmissions that use the same channel used to monitor the user devices, or shifted channel transmissions that are different than the channel used to monitor the user devices. For example, a media hub device may passively monitor customer devices by scanning a wireless communication channel and obtaining device identification information transmitted by a user device that communicates the device identification information via the wireless communication channel. A media hub device may link the user device with a particular user or may anonymously monitor user behavior, through the monitored user device, without explicit knowledge of the identity of the user. Targeted media may be provided to the user device either in-channel using the same channel used to passively monitor the user device or a shifted channel using a different channel.

  • Patent number: 10643195
    Abstract: Various systems and methods of self-configuring networked media hub devices with failover recovery of peers are disclosed. For example, a media hub device may be configured in an “out-of-the-box” solution in which the media hub, upon startup, obtains configuration data from a remote device. Peer media hub devices may be connected to one another via a local network and may each be self-configured in the same manner. Each media hub device may monitor other media hub devices on the local network. Based on such monitoring, each media hub device may detect that one of the media hub devices is offline and a new media hub device is online. One or more of the online media hub devices may automatically configure the new media hub device using the offline media hub device's configuration data, thereby configuring the new media hub device to replace the offline media hub device.
